Squad train on Saturday after derby result
Hours on from their derby draw against Levante UD at Mestalla, Valencia CF were back in training in a Saturday afternoon session. The squad are now turning their focus to their next game up, against Real Madrid on Thursday night (10pm CEST).

The players were disappointed with the result from Friday, sharing a point with their city rivals, but were determined to put the game behind them and keep working on their fitness and tactical skills. Coach Albert Celades gave the instructions over the course of a recovery session.

The fixture list is packed for the coming weeks, and 10 games remain before the end of the season. The squad remain determined to qualify for the Champions League next term.
